PIC16C74A-10/P Specifications

  • Type
    Parameter
  • Supplier Device Package
    40-PDIP
  • Package / Case
    40-DIP (0.600", 15.24mm)
  • Mounting Type
    Through Hole
  • Operating Temperature
    0°C ~ 70°C (TA)
  • Oscillator Type
    External
  • Data Converters
    A/D 8x8b
  • Voltage - Supply (Vcc/Vdd)
    4V ~ 6V
  • RAM Size
    192 x 8
  • EEPROM Size
    -
  • Program Memory Type
    OTP
  • Program Memory Size
    7KB (4K x 14)
  • Number of I/O
    33
  • Peripherals
    Brown-out Detect/Reset, POR, PWM, WDT
  • Connectivity
    I²C, SPI, UART/USART
  • Speed
    10MHz
  • Core Size
    8-Bit
  • Core Processor
    PIC
  • DigiKey Programmable
    Verified
  • Packaging
    Tube
  • Product Status
    Active
  • Series
    PIC® 16C
The PIC16C74A-10/P is a microcontroller integrated circuit chip developed by Microchip Technology. It offers several advantages and can be applied in various scenarios. Here are some of its advantages and application scenarios:Advantages: 1. Low power consumption: The PIC16C74A-10/P is designed to operate at low power levels, making it suitable for battery-powered devices or applications where power efficiency is crucial. 2. High performance: With a 10 MHz clock speed, this microcontroller chip offers fast processing capabilities, enabling it to handle complex tasks efficiently. 3. Integrated peripherals: The PIC16C74A-10/P includes various integrated peripherals such as timers, UART (Universal Asynchronous Receiver-Transmitter), and ADC (Analog-to-Digital Converter), which simplify the design process and reduce the need for external components. 4. Ample memory: It has 4 KB of program memory (Flash) and 192 bytes of RAM, providing sufficient space for storing program code and data. 5. Cost-effective: The PIC16C74A-10/P is a cost-effective solution due to its affordability and the availability of development tools and resources.Application Scenarios: 1. Embedded systems: The PIC16C74A-10/P is commonly used in embedded systems, such as industrial automation, home appliances, and consumer electronics, where it can control various functions and interface with external devices. 2. Sensor-based applications: With its integrated ADC, the chip is suitable for applications that require analog signal processing, such as sensor interfacing, data acquisition, and measurement systems. 3. Communication devices: The UART module in the PIC16C74A-10/P enables it to communicate with other devices using serial communication protocols, making it suitable for applications like data logging, wireless communication, and IoT (Internet of Things) devices. 4. Automotive electronics: The low power consumption and robust design of the PIC16C74A-10/P make it suitable for automotive applications, including engine control units, dashboard displays, and vehicle diagnostics. 5. Educational projects: Due to its affordability, ease of use, and availability of development tools, the PIC16C74A-10/P is often used in educational settings for teaching microcontroller programming and basic electronics.It's important to note that the PIC16C74A-10/P is an older microcontroller chip, and Microchip Technology has since released newer and more advanced versions.
